Strategy! Let the AI send convoys to your planets. He uses money and fleet for it, thus weakening himself. You get the production bonus, it's a win-win situation ^^ Pirates? You can do 2 things with pirates. Buy a mission from them, and put bounty on other peeps in order to get pirates to attack them.
